Earthquake jolts Valley

Srinagar: A moderate intensity earthquake with epicenter in Pakistan struck Jammu and Kashmir at around 1 pm on Saturday, an official said.
Tremors were felt in many parts of the Valley, but there were no reports of loss of life or damage to property, he said.
The 5.8 magnitude earthquake occurred at a latitude of 33.63 degrees North and longitude of 72.46 degrees East in Pakistan at a depth of 10 kilometers, the official said.
